← ScienceWhich outcome results when anisotropic crystals cause birefringence?
A)Polarization direction experiences phase retardation✓
B)Excited electron emits monochromatic photons
C)Destructive interference eliminates light
D)Beam divergence remains minimally affected
💡 Explanation
Birefringence causes polarization direction phase retardation because crystals divide light into ordinary and extraordinary rays, therefore changing polarization. The polarization effect is responsible, rather than wavelength changes or interference that occurs under different conditions.
